A suspect in a handbag theft detained at Ercan Airport in Northern Cyprus
In Northern Cyprus, at Ercan Airport, a theft of a women’s handbag forgotten by a passenger occurred on October 25, 2025, at around 21:00; one person has been detained as part of the investigation.
According to police, the bag contained 2,000 US dollars, wireless headphones, glasses and an electronic cigarette. After the loss was reported, an investigation was launched to establish the circumstances of the incident and identify those involved.
A 51-year-old H.S. was sought as a suspect in the case. He was detained on December 14, 2025, while entering the TRNC via Ercan Airport and was taken into custody in connection with the ongoing investigation.
The investigation into the theft is continuing; no additional details have been reported.
